    News Sequoia launches $1.35B fund to invest in startups in India and South-East Asia

    Sequoia Capital has announced the creation of two new funds totalling $1.35 billion dedicated to investment opportunities in India. The two new investment vehicles of the marquee venture capital fund will be a $525 million venture fund and $825 million growth fund.
